Method for making mushroom culture medium by using kitchen waste and grape branches as main materials

The invention discloses a method for making a mushroom culture medium by using kitchen waste and grape branches as main materials, and belongs to the technical field of edible fungi cultivation. The culture medium is prepared from main raw materials of treated kitchen waste and grape branches and urea and wheat bran as auxiliary materials through adding a mixed bacterium agent and a mixed enzyme and adding auxin through controlling the fermentation by stage type temperatures. According to the method for making the mushroom culture medium, provided by the invention, organic macromolecular substances and substances such as lignin, cellulose, hemicellulose and pectin in the grape branches, which are available to edible mushrooms, can be rapidly and effectively degraded, and transformed into micromolecular substances which can be utilized and absorbed by mushroom hypha, so that the source of raw materials of the mushroom culture medium is enlarged, the production cost of the mushroom is reduced, the cultured mushroom is good in shape and delicious in taste, the yield and quality of the mushroom are improved, the cyclic utilization of changing the kitchen waste and the grape branches into valuables is realized, and the pressure faced by the municipal environment is solved.

Fermented biomass multifunctional soil conditioner, and preparation and application methods thereof

The invention provides a fermented biomass multifunctional soil conditioner, and a preparation method and application thereof. The soil conditioner comprises the following main components in terms ofdry weight: 320-700 g/kg of organic matters, 7-25 g/kg of total nitrogen, 150-350 g/kg of humus, 3-15 g/kg of available phosphorus and 3*10<4> to 6.7*10<7> CFU/g of beneficial bacteria. The preparation method comprises the following steps: adding a biotransformation derivative into organic solid waste, and performing aerobic high-temperature biotransformation, stack retting, drying and crushing byusing a physicochemical-biological enhanced rapid aerobic biological fermentation method, thereby obtaining the fermented biomass multifunctional soil conditioner. The soil conditioner can be appliedto improvement and remediation of barren, degraded and salinized soil and soil with continuous cropping obstacles, and has the effects of obviously improving the physical and chemical properties of the soil, enhancing the soil permeability and improving a soil structure; the soil conditioner neutralizes the acidity and alkalinity of the soil, improves the microflora structure of the soil, and hasremarkable effects on crop growth and development and other aspects; and the fermented biomass multifunctional soil conditioner has the advantages of waste resource utilization, remarkable ecologicalbenefits and economic benefits and the like.

Pneumatic zero-speed hole-pricking liquid fertilizer deep application mechanism

The invention relates to a pneumatic zero-speed hole-pricking liquid fertilizer deep application mechanism and belongs to agricultural machinery. N liquid fertilizer application needle assemblies are inserted in a moving flat plate in a telescopic movable mode; a pressing plate is assembled on the upper parts of the liquid fertilizer application needle assemblies; a steel pipe and a support are fixedly arranged on the moving flat plate; the steel pipe is communicated with the liquid fertilizer application needle assemblies; an air cylinder rod arranged on a vertical air cylinder on the support is connected with the pressing plate; the moving flat plate is arranged on the back side part of a fixedly arranged horizontal air cylinder; a main gas pipe is used for communicating a gas pump with an air cylinder motion controller; a lead is used for communicating a speed measuring sensor with the air cylinder motion controller; the horizontal air cylinder is used for communicating the air cylinder motion controller with the horizontal air cylinder; a gas pipe of the vertical air cylinder is used for communicating the air cylinder motion controller with the vertical air cylinder; and a hose is used for communicating a liquid pump with the steel pipe. The pneumatic zero-speed hole-pricking liquid fertilizer deep application mechanism is reasonable in structure, high in automation degree, high in hole-pricking operation and fertilizer application operation quality, high in fertilizer efficiency utilization rate and low in environmental pollution, and is favorable for growth and absorption of crops.

A cultivation method for high-quality seedlings of taxus cuspidate

The invention provides a cultivation method for high-quality seedlings of taxus cuspidate and relates to the field of seedling planting. The method comprises the steps of: oil preparation and bedding: deeply ploughing and fully cultivating planting land, performing ditching and bedding and then performing fertilizing, tilling and watering; seed selection and processing: collecting seeds of taxus cuspidate, drying the seeds, controlling the water content of the seeds of taxus cuspidate, and storing the seeds for seeding; seeding management: performing tilling once before seeding, performing deep tilling and shallow seeding, mulching the seeds after sowing, and taking off the plastic film after sprouts emerge from soil; seedling culture management: applying an insecticide and fertilizer once every month, trimming branches when seedlings grow to 15cm, performing grafting according to a square budding method, removing peripheral weeds and performing thinning; branch clipping: cutting excessively-growing branches and overcrowded branches to maintain a proper density of tree forms. The method is low in planting cost and can increase the sprouting rate and survival rate of seeds and shorten the outplanting period of finished-product taxus cuspidate; cultured plants are good in growth vigor, high in quality and good and beautiful in shape and are neat and robust.

Biochar-based organic special fertilizer for watermelons and production method thereof

The invention provides a biochar-based organic special fertilizer for watermelons and a production method thereof. The special fertilizer is prepared from the following components in parts by weight:30-40 parts of biochar, 40-60 parts of organic materials, 6-8 parts of nitrogen (N2), 2-4 parts of phosphorus (P2O5), 6-9 parts of potassium (K2O), 10-15 parts of perlite, 1-2 parts of potassium sulfate, 1-2 parts of ammonium sulfate, 0.5-1 part of ammonium nitrate, 0.5-1 part of humic acid, 1.5-2.5 parts of wood vinegar, 1-2 parts of wood tar, 0.05-1 part of a probiotic agent, 0.5-1 part of a fertilizer controlled release agent, and 1-3 parts of a forming aid. The organic matters are solid livestock and poultry manure and decomposed organic plants with the water content of less than or equalto 40%. The preparation method comprises the following steps: carrying out high-temperature pyrolysis on crop straws to prepare biochar, adding the biochar and organic matters into a fermentation tank, carrying out mixed fermentation for 10-20 days, adding an ingredient granulator into the base material, granulating the mixture and finally spraying wood tar onto the granular fertilizer. The special fertilizer contains a large amount of organic nutrient elements, effectively utilizes waste resources, improves sandy soil, is suitable for planting watermelons, and improves taste and yield.

Method for improving heavily-viscous saline-alkali soil to plant shrubs and application thereof

The invention discloses a method for improving heavily-viscous saline-alkali soil to plant shrubs and application thereof. The method includes the steps of forming ridges on the land in a planting area, and constructing drainage channels at the interval of 25-35 m in the direction parallel to the ridges; constructing drainage ditches at the interval 20-25 m in the direction perpendicular to the ridges, communicating the drainage ditches with a peripheral water system, and laying dug-out mounds on the ground surface for heightening to form microtopography; conducting rotary tillage on the soilin the planting area until the maximum width of a soil block is smaller than 2 cm, applying a saline-alkali soil synergistic conditioner and an organic fertilizer, conducting horizontal and transversedeep plowing on the soil so that the soil conditioner and the organic fertilizer can be sufficiently and evenly mixed with the soil, and covering the root ground surface with a grass mat by the thickness of 1-3 cm after shrub seedlings are planted. By means of the method, the structure of the heavily-viscous saline-alkali soil can be improved, salt pouring can be accelerated, salt returning can be prevented, the nutrient state of the soil is improved, the salt content and pH value of the soil are reduced, the harm of salt and alkali to the greening shrubs is relieved, the survival rate of theshrubs is increased, and the sustainable development of heavily-viscous saline-alkali soil greening is promoted.

Cultivation method capable of improving tea leaves

The invention relates to a cultivation method capable of improving tea leaves. The method comprises the steps of land selection, seeding selection, field planting and moisture and fertilizer management; the water and fertilizer management comprises moisture management and fertilizing management; the moisture management is to maintain the moisture of field planting land at 45%-55%; the fertilizing management is to apply organic fertilizer as base fertilizer before field planting, wherein the applying amount is 450-650 kg/mu (a Chinese area unit and equal to 666.67 m2); topdressing is conducted with the organic fertilizer in June, July or August every year from the second year, wherein the applying amount of topdressing is 200-300 kg/mu; the organic fertilizer is prepared from ailanthus, acorus calamus, garlic, fleur-de-lis, erilla frutescens (L.) Britt., aster, pericarpium citri reticulatae, pleurotus eryngii trimmings, zinc oxide mineral powder, portulaca oleracea, corn germ, lemon, se-enriched yeast, enterococcus faecium, lactobacillus acidophilus, Nocard's bacillus, bacillus subtilis and lactobacillus plantarum. According to the cultivation method capable of improving the tea leaves, the content of selenium and zinc elements in the tea leaves can be increased, phenomena of plant diseases and insect pests are reduced, the yield per mu is increased, and accordingly economic benefits are improved.

Lucid ganoderma cultivation medium and preparation method thereof

The invention discloses a lucid ganoderma cultivation medium and a preparation method thereof. The lucid ganoderma cultivation medium is prepared from the following raw materials in parts by weight: 20-30 parts of elm branches, 18-28 parts of weed tree sawdust, 8-15 parts of bone meal, 10-15 parts of trichosanthes kirilowii Maxim shell, 5-10 parts of distillers dried grains with soluble, 4-8 parts of worm dung, 8-15 parts of cushaw stem, 5-10 parts of grape seed meal, 4-8 parts of marigold residues, 10-15 parts of bagasse, 0.3-0.6 part of monopotassium phosphate, 0.3-0.6 part of potassium nitrate, 0.3-0.5 part of calcium ammonium nitrate, 1-3 parts of discard molasses, 4-6 parts of plant ash, 1-3 parts of land plaster and 5-10 parts of nutrition additives. According to the cultivation medium disclosed by the invention, raw materials such as cushaw stem and grape seed meal are added on the basis of the traditional sawdust raw materials, cushaw stem and grape seed meal are abundant and are rich in various nutritive elements, and therefore the forest resource pressure is relieved. Meanwhile, the added nutrition additives are good for absorption and growth of lucid ganoderma, the utilization rate of the cultivation medium is improved, the biotransformation rate is increased, and the lucid ganoderma is wide, thick and solid in cover and strong in stem, rich in nutrients and high in medical property.

Preparation method of environment-friendly pasty anti-blocking agent

The invention discloses a preparation method of an environment-friendly pasty anti-blocking agent, which belongs to the technical field of preparation of agricultural materials. The preparation method comprises the following steps: firstly mixing and heating two natural fatty alcohol to obtain a mixture I, enabling the mixture I to react with phosphorus pentoxide to obtain mixed fatty alcohol phosphate, compounding the mixed fatty alcohol phosphate with soybean oil, zinc stearate and the like to obtain a material solution, activating attapulgite by using a sulfuric acid solution, mixing, grinding and drying the attapulgite and talcum powder, then mixing with the material solution, thus obtaining the environment-friendly pasty anti-blocking agent. A hydrophobic layer is formed by oil on the surface of fertilizer, the attapulgite forms an isolation layer on the hydrophobic layer, moisture in the fertilizer can also be effectively absorbed, and the frequency of the dissolving-crystallizing process of a fertilizer salt solution can be further reduced, so that the blocking performance of the fertilizer is reduced; and the environment-friendly pasty anti-blocking agent can effectively improve the anti-blocking performance of the fertilizer, can significantly increase the utilization rate of the fertilizer, and is good in biological degradability, free from polluting the soil and peripheral environment, and good in application effect.

Feed for herbivorous fishes and preparation method thereof

The invention discloses a feed for herbivorous fishes. The feed comprises one or more selected from the group consisting of bone meal, wheat bran, bean cake, rice bran, rapeseeds, a composite vitamin premix, a traditional Chinese medicinal composite additive, a mineral matter premix and a feed adhesive. The traditional Chinese medicinal composite additive further comprises the following traditional Chinese medicine bulk drugs: dyers woad leaves, common andrographis herb, Indian bread, root of large-flowered skullcap, weeping forsythia capsule, patrinia herb, curcuma tuber, heartleaf houttuynia herb, Chinese magnoliavine fruit, red sage root, dodder seeds, tangshen, milkvetch root, heydyotis and white peony root. According to the invention, the feed for herbivorous fishes is in accordance with demands for intensive and large-scale production in the current aquaculture industry; a compound preparation is prepared from raw materials for the feed according to a certain proportion, which enables synergistic effects of the bulk drugs in the traditional Chinese medicinal composite additive to be better performed; a steaming process is utilized to allow starch in the feed adhesive to agglutinate at different temperatures, so the degree of expansion is increased, the degree of gelatinization of the starch is substantially improved, the effects of a chemical adhesive in feed processing can be totally replaced, and sinking performance and binding performance of the feed are enhanced, which is beneficial for growth and culture of herbivorous fishes and enables good economic benefits and social benefits to be created.

Nutritional type water-retention and soil-loosening compound fertilizer and preparation method thereof

The invention discloses nutritional type water-retention and soil-loosening compound fertilizer and a preparation method thereof, and belongs to the technical field of fertilizer. The nutritional typewater-retention and soil-loosening compound fertilizer is prepared from the following raw materials in parts by weight: 20-30 parts of cow dung, 5-10 parts of sawdust, 5-10 parts of straw, 0.1-0.3 part of EM beneficial microorganisms, 5-10 parts of wormcast, 10-20 parts of shell powder, 0.05-0.1 part of polyaspartic acid, 3-5 parts of superphosphate, 15-20 parts of potassium chloride and 15-20 parts of urea. By adding the polyaspartic acid, the slow release effect of the polyaspartic acid is utilized, softening of the shell powder is accelerated in the using process of the fertilizer, the fertilizer efficiency wrapped inside the fertilizer is released conveniently and supplied to plants for growing durably and rapidly, the activity of humic acid in the fermentation fertilizer is improvedthrough the polyaspartic acid, the fertilizer can be combined with metal ions in water, nutritional elements are conveyed to crops advantageously, nitrogen, phosphorus, potassium and trace elements are enriched to supplied to the plants, thus the fertilizer is better utilized by the plants, the yield of the crops is increased, the quality of the crops is improved, the soil quality can be improved,and absorption and growth of the plants are facilitated.
